Taken with the third overall pick in the 2012 NFL Draft, Richardson landed with the Cleveland Browns and was drafted behind only Stanford QB Andrew Luck and Baylor QB Robert Griffin III, the only two players to rank above him in Heisman voting that season. After that, Richardson signed a two-year, $3.85 million deal with the then-Oakland Raiders in 2015, but was released five months into the contract and never played a down for them. Richardson revealed to Shelley Smith on ESPN's "E:60" that his family and friends spent $1.6 million of his money in a 10-month span from January to October of 2015.
